Open Beta Date Announced for Arctic Combat

Webzen has announced that Arctic Combat will begin open beta on December 6.
The tactical shooter has been gathering feedback during closed beta and the team is hard at work to improve the game to optimize it for players’ best experience. While the clock counts down, Arctic Combat will reveal new details through its Facebook page, and hold user-events through the official Arctic Combat website.
Arctic Combat will be holding its North American and European region finals on October 27 and 28; the winning teams will be invited to South Korea for the Veterans League World Championship during G-Star 2012.
Jihun Lee, Head of Global Publishing, said, “We are very excited to announce our official open beta date for Arctic Combat the anticipated high quality contents and service.” Also he said, “We look forward to seeing who will become the first to represent their region at the World Championship finals.”
